Jan Cornelius

Source: Potthast, Heinrich, Die Familien der Kirchengemeinde Forlitz-Blaukirchen (16778 - 1910), Band XC, (Aurich, Upstalsboom-Gesellschaft, MMXI), Seiten 101 u. 127, Repository: MN Gen. Soc. Lib., No. St. Paul, MN

Vergleich = possibly the same Jan Cornelius heading family 138 as is found in family 284

[Seite 101]

"138 Corneljes, Jan (Johann Cornelies 1730) vgl.284, /=OSB Engerhafe 535/, Arbeiter 1764, Warfsmann zu Forlitz, * (1715), com. 1766 F/B, + 12.12.(3.Advent 1790 Forlitz, 85/-/-, vor Alter u. durch manche Zufälle vermehrter Schwachheit, oo 11.05. (Com Cantate) 1727 F/S Judlike (Judke 1728, Judith 1750) Jacobs, OSB Engerhafe 2591, * 16.01.1709 Engerhafe, com. 1766 F/B, + 13.05.1793 Forlitz, 85/-/-, Schwachheit,

1. Ancke (Antie) * 17. ~ 18.04.1728 Dom. Jubilate F/S Tp: Cornelius Geriets, Reenste Cornelius u. Elisabeth Pubts, + 26.01. # 02.02.1752 F/S, "Jann Cornelies älteste Tochter Antie + am 02. Febr. das Fest der Vereinigung Maria 1752",
2. Gretie 327, 614, * 25. ~ 26.02.1730 F/S uxor mea Johanna Dorothea Beckern, Eveke Jansen,
3. Cornelius Geriets 447, * 20. ~ 22.04.1732 F/S Tp: Albert Jacobs, Harm Jansen u. Antien Corneliesa,
4. Jantie * 24. ~ 27.12.1734 F/S Tp: Jürjen Heyen, Trintie Wolbrechs u. Geeßke Hemmen u. Trintie Jürgens,
5. Trintie * /~ 17.04.1737 F/S Tp: Ego Nicol. Becker, Past. loci, Tiabeke Hemmen u. Trintie Jürgens,
6. Jacob Janssen 483, * 29. ~ 30.04.1739 F/S Tp: Pupt Focken Alberts, Heye Jürgens u. Altie Geicken,
7. Heye 476, * 23. ~ 25.02.1742 F/S (Oculi) Tp: Claß Janßen, Ehemann der Hilcke Tiardts, Willem Rewenß u. Maria Dorothea Bentzen aus Jena,
8. Christlina 441, 302, * 10. ~ 13.05.1745 F/S Tp: Brechte Janßen, Brechte Cornelies u. Harm Janßen,
9. Martie (Martje), * 31.12.1750, ~ 01.01.1751 F/S Tp: Reenste Cornelies, Elsche Jürienß u. Hinrich Lüppen, + 28. # 30.09.1753 F/S.,"

[Seite 127]

"284 Gerjets, Cornelies (Corneließen), /=OSB Barstede 385/, Hausmann zu Südwold, Kirchvogd zu Blaukirchen, + 18.mittags, # 23.05.1720 Blaukirchen (L-Text: Joh.II 25,26), Schatzungsregister v. 1719: Karckvoigdt, Ehefrau u. 3 Söhne, einkleiner Herd in Südwolde, oo Ancke (Anneke) Hayen, + 18. (des Morgens vor Tage is A.H., Corn.Gerj.nachgelassene Witwe selig entschlafen) # 23.07.1720 Blaukirchen (L-Text: Luc. 2: 29,30), ...
7. Jan Cornelius, * 1705, (vgl. 138)" <>
